当我调用时,我可以将咖啡文件编译为与.coffee/.js文件位于同一目录中的.map文件coffee--nodejs--debug-brkapp.coffee并启动Node检查器。应用程序文件的js版本在chrome中加载。我错过了什么??这就是chrome为three.coffee文件显示的内容..(function(exports,require,module,__filename,__dirname){//GeneratedbyCoffeeScript1.6.2(function(){app.get('/three',function(req,res){debugger;ret
我需要帮助将源映射添加到同一个CSS输出文件夹中的SASS编译器。到目前为止,我必须在gulpfile.js中安装gulp-sourcemaps模块,但不知道将sourcemaps.write绑定(bind)为gulp.task是否成功。非常感谢任何帮助:)vargulp=require('gulp');varsass=require('gulp-sass');varsourcemaps=require('gulp-sourcemaps');varbs=require('browser-sync').create();gulp.task('browser-sync',['sass'],
我需要帮助将源映射添加到同一个CSS输出文件夹中的SASS编译器。到目前为止,我必须在gulpfile.js中安装gulp-sourcemaps模块,但不知道将sourcemaps.write绑定(bind)为gulp.task是否成功。非常感谢任何帮助:)vargulp=require('gulp');varsass=require('gulp-sass');varsourcemaps=require('gulp-sourcemaps');varbs=require('browser-sync').create();gulp.task('browser-sync',['sass'],
是否可以加载外部源映射文件(JSON),而不包含在网站上使用的缩小JS文件中?到目前为止,我所知道的为特定js文件包含源映射的唯一方法是内联它、在注释中添加链接或在HTTPheader中设置路径。所以我想知道-是否可以加载无法通过HTTP访问的源映射文件?例如-从我的本地驱动器加载它,并将它指向它应该映射的js文件?干杯 最佳答案 我知道问题很老,但我自己还是有。以下是您在Chromium63中的操作方式打开调试器在源代码区右击选择“添加源映射…”输入源映射文件的URL如果浏览器能够下载并处理它,那么源将作为条目出现在源树中。使用隐
我正在部署我的网站——一个用GatsbyJS构建的静态网站——我的源map是迄今为止我最大的文件。我有3个大约3MB的sourcemap文件。总体而言,它们可能占我构建的70%。我应该将它们部署到我的生产服务器吗?sourcemaps是否仅由打开devtools的用户下载? 最佳答案 考虑whatasourcemapis你只需要考虑到:如果它们是公开提供的,用户可以访问您的源代码(当然是onlyifsourcemapfilesarerequestedwiththepropertools)。需要更多磁盘空间(在您的情况下约为3MB)但
当我使用Chromedevtools调试器时,我遇到了一个问题,即Webpack使用inline-source-map配置设置生成的源映射偏离一行。Webpack在RubyonRails应用程序中设置,以生成由几十个模块组成的串联的、未缩小的JavaScript文件。这些模块中的大部分都是ReactJS组件,并由jsx加载器解析。然后,Webpack的输出与gems生成的一些其他JavaScript库一起包含在application.js文件中。当我使用eval-source-map时,没有问题。关于使用inline-source-map的一些事情导致行号被一个丢弃。检查非React组
我正在从一个文件中加载一个脚本,并且我正在使用eval()生成这样的Javascript代码:varcode=fs.readFileSync('myfile');varshiftedCode='function(param){'+code+'}\n'+'//#sourceURL=myfile';eval(shiftedCode)问题是当我在代码中放置断点或调试器时,它会在正确的行之后停止两行,因为我想在开头添加了字符。有没有办法将sourceURL转移到正确的起点,可能是使用源映射?提前感谢您的帮助。 最佳答案 定义问题我看到您正在
我决定在我今天正在启动的一个新项目中尝试WebPack,我从源映射中得到了非常奇怪的行为。我在文档中找不到任何关于它的内容,在浏览StackOverflow时也找不到其他人遇到此问题。我目前正在查看Vue-CLI'sWebPacktemplate制作的HelloWorld应用程序。--没有对代码、构建环境或任何东西进行任何更改。我安装了所有东西并像这样运行它:vueinitwebpacktest&&cdtest&&npminstall&&npmrundev查看我的源map,我看到以下内容:这是一团糟。为什么会有三个版本的HelloWorld.vue和App.vue?更糟糕的是,每个版本
我是webpack的新手,我需要帮助设置以生成源映射。我从命令行运行webpackserve,编译成功。但我真的需要源图。这是我的webpack.config.js。varwebpack=require('webpack');module.exports={output:{filename:'main.js',publicPath:'/assets/'},cache:true,debug:true,devtool:true,entry:['webpack/hot/only-dev-server','./src/components/main.js'],stats:{colors:tru
我是webpack的新手,我需要帮助设置以生成源映射。我从命令行运行webpackserve,编译成功。但我真的需要源图。这是我的webpack.config.js。varwebpack=require('webpack');module.exports={output:{filename:'main.js',publicPath:'/assets/'},cache:true,debug:true,devtool:true,entry:['webpack/hot/only-dev-server','./src/components/main.js'],stats:{colors:tru